- Como adicionar item ao matriz em MongoDB?
- Como você empurra um elemento para uma matriz aninhada?
- Como armazenar objeto aninhado em MongoDB?
- Você pode anexar itens a uma matriz?
- Você pode adicionar itens a uma matriz?
- Como faço para empurrar um valor para uma matriz em JSON?
- Como você empurra um elemento de matriz em uma matriz?
- Como você acessa dados em matrizes aninhadas?
- Como faço para atualizar vários elementos em MongoDB?
- Como faço para atualizar vários registros em MongoDB?
- Qual é a diferença entre inserção e insertmany em mongodb?
- Como faço para anexar vários elementos de uma só vez?
- O que é insertmany em mongodb?
Como adicionar item ao matriz em MongoDB?
No MongoDB, o operador $ push é usado para anexar um valor especificado a uma matriz. Se o campo mencionado estiver ausente no documento a ser atualizado, o operador $ push o adicionará como um novo campo e inclui o valor mencionado como seu elemento.
Como você empurra um elemento para uma matriz aninhada?
O JavaScript oferece duas maneiras de adicionar elementos a uma matriz aninhada já criada; Você pode anexar um elemento no final de uma matriz usando o método "push ()" ou inseri -lo em uma posição específica com a ajuda do método "splice ()".
Como armazenar objeto aninhado em MongoDB?
No MongoDB, você pode acessar os campos de documentos aninhados/incorporados da coleção usando a notação de pontos e quando você está usando a notação do DOT, então o campo e o campo aninhado devem estar dentro das aspas.
Você pode anexar itens a uma matriz?
Com o módulo da matriz, você pode concatenar ou unir matrizes usando o operador + e você pode adicionar elementos a uma matriz usando os métodos Append (), Extend () e Insert ().
Você pode adicionar itens a uma matriz?
Quando você deseja adicionar um elemento ao final da sua matriz, use push () . Se você precisar adicionar um elemento ao início da sua matriz, use o não . Se você deseja adicionar um elemento a um local específico da sua matriz, use Splice () .
Como faço para empurrar um valor para uma matriz em JSON?
Abordagem 1: Primeiro converta a string json para o objeto JavaScript usando JSON. Método parse () e depois retire os valores do objeto e empurre -os para a matriz usando o método push ().
Como você empurra um elemento de matriz em uma matriz?
Use a função concat, assim: var Arraya = [1, 2]; var Arrayb = [3, 4]; var newArray = Arraya. concat (Arrayb); O valor de NewArray será [1, 2, 3, 4] (Arraya e Arrayb permanecem inalterados; Concat cria e retorna uma nova matriz para o resultado).
Como você acessa dados em matrizes aninhadas?
Para acessar os elementos das matrizes internas, você simplesmente usa dois conjuntos de colchetes quadrados. Por exemplo, animais de estimação [1] [2] acessam o terceiro elemento da matriz dentro do 2º elemento da matriz de animais de estimação.
Como faço para atualizar vários elementos em MongoDB?
Atualize vários campos de um único documento. Podemos usar os operadores $ SET e $ incurs para atualizar qualquer campo em MongoDB. O operador $ SET definirá o valor recém -especificado, enquanto o operador $ inc aumentará o valor por um valor especificado.
Como faço para atualizar vários registros em MongoDB?
Você pode atualizar vários documentos usando a coleção. Método updatemany (). O método updatemany () aceita um documento de filtro e um documento de atualização. Se a consulta corresponder aos documentos da coleção, o método aplicará as atualizações do documento de atualização para campos e valores dos documentos correspondentes.
Qual é a diferença entre inserção e insertmany em mongodb?
Com insertona, você pode inserir um documento na coleção. InsertMany aceita uma variedade de documentos e estes são inseridos. A inserção (o método das versões mais antigas) leva um único documento por padrão, e há uma opção para inserir vários documentos fornecidos como uma matriz.
Como faço para anexar vários elementos de uma só vez?
Dado a = [1, 2, 3], você também pode anexar vários elementos como a += [4, 5, 6] . Isso define A a [1, 2, 3, 4, 5, 6] . Isso não cria uma nova lista; Cada elemento é anexado a um . (Teste isso com a = [1, 2, 3]; b = a; a += [4, 5, 6] e você verá que A e B ainda são os mesmos.)
O que é insertmany em mongodb?
Dada uma variedade de documentos, InsertMany () insere cada documento na matriz na coleção.